help-smalltalk
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Help-smalltalk] [PATCH 1/2] lint: Add missing categories to classes in


From: Holger Hans Peter Freyther
Subject: [Help-smalltalk] [PATCH 1/2] lint: Add missing categories to classes in the kernel
Date: Mon, 9 Jan 2012 23:35:10 +0100

From: Holger Hans Peter Freyther <address@hidden>

Object allSubclasses select: [:each | each category isNil]
---
 ChangeLog           |    7 +++++++
 kernel/File.st      |    1 +
 kernel/PkgLoader.st |    4 ++++
 kernel/VFS.st       |    1 +
 4 files changed, 13 insertions(+), 0 deletions(-)

diff --git a/ChangeLog b/ChangeLog
index 7636c82..5ef795a 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,8 +1,15 @@
+2011-09-25  Holger Hans Peter Freyther  <address@hidden>
+
+       * kernel/File.st: Add a <category: 'text'> to the class.
+       * kernel/PkgLoader.st: Ditto.
+       * kernel/VFS.st: Ditto.
+
 2011-11-28  Paolo Bonzini  <address@hidden>
 
        * scripts/Package.st: Use #symlinkFrom: to create absolute-path
        symlinks.
 
+
 2011-11-23  Paolo Bonzini  <address@hidden>
 
        * kernel/AnsiDates.st: Improve #readFrom: to not read ahead too much
diff --git a/kernel/File.st b/kernel/File.st
index 3cc77eb..426a415 100644
--- a/kernel/File.st
+++ b/kernel/File.st
@@ -646,6 +646,7 @@ FilePath subclass: File [
 Namespace current: Kernel [
 
 Object subclass: Stat [
+    <category: 'Streams-Files'>
     
     | stMode stSize stAtime stMtime stCtime |
     stMode [ ^stMode ]
diff --git a/kernel/PkgLoader.st b/kernel/PkgLoader.st
index c3aac39..8a3a429 100644
--- a/kernel/PkgLoader.st
+++ b/kernel/PkgLoader.st
@@ -388,6 +388,8 @@ Namespace current: Kernel [
 PackageContainer subclass: PackageDirectory [
     | baseDirectories baseDirCache |
 
+    <category: 'Language-Packaging'>
+
     PackageContainer class >> on: aFile baseDirectories: aBlock [
        <category: 'accessing'>
        ^(super new)
@@ -1108,6 +1110,8 @@ Namespace current: Kernel [
 Object subclass: Version [
     | major minor patch |
 
+    <category: 'Language-Packaging'>
+
     Version class >> fromString: aString [
        <category: 'instance creation'>
 
diff --git a/kernel/VFS.st b/kernel/VFS.st
index 62b8d97..75e214d 100644
--- a/kernel/VFS.st
+++ b/kernel/VFS.st
@@ -347,6 +347,7 @@ virtual files that refer to a real file on disk.'>
 Namespace current: Kernel [
 
 VFS.FileWrapper subclass: RecursiveFileWrapper [
+    <category: 'Streams-Files'>
 
      do: aBlock [
        "Same as the wrapped #do:, but reuses the file object for efficiency."
-- 
1.7.8.2




reply via email to

[Prev in Thread] Current Thread [Next in Thread]